That had not held true, before the First Globe Battle, when the bulk of residential car manufacturers instantly restored their supplier franchise business at the end of the calendar year. bill berardino. Automatic revival managed a particular degree of business safety specifically for low volume representatives. Franchise business revival assurances like that had actually all however disappeared by 1925 as automobile suppliers consistently ended their least successful electrical outlets.
Some Known Details About Kollective Automotive Group
Such unsympathetic procedures only softened after the 2nd World War when some domestic car manufacturers started to prolong the size of franchise business agreements from one to five years. Carmakers might have still booked the right to end agreements at will; however, several franchise agreements, beginning in the 1950s, included a new arrangement aimed directly at another equally troublesome problem namely protecting car dealership sequence.

Automobile dealers provide a variety of services associated to the trading of autos. Among their primary functions is to act as middlemans (or middlemen) in between vehicle producers and clients, getting vehicles straight from the maker and after that offering them to customers at a markup. In addition, they commonly offer financing choices for customers and will certainly assist with the trade-in or sale of a client's old car.
